-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
jmeter,生成测试报告
嘉应学院计算机学院 实验报告 课程名称指导老师班级 软件测试 实验名称实验时间姓名 压力测试工具JMeter实践第11周 实验地点提交时间座号 锡科405第12周 一、实验目的和要求 学习目标:学习和掌握测试工具JMeter的使用。 知识要点:JMeter的要测试部件,创建测试计划和参数方法。 二、实验环境、内容和方法 实验环境:Windows7压力测试工具JMeter 三、实验过程描述 1、JMeter的安装和运行 2、JMeter实例 多用户同时登录大学学籍管理系统 ①运行badboy录制,在URL栏输入 http://localhost:8080/myapp ②将脚本导出为JMeter脚本 得到原始的JMeter脚本,用JMeter打开 修改原始脚本 ③设置响应断言,添加响应文本 ④添加聚合报告 ⑤添加查看结果树 成功的请求 江西理工大学软件学院 计算机类课程 课程名称: 班级: 姓名: 学号:实验报告软件测试121班温鹏辉 一、实验目的: 运用Jmeter进行一个简单web测试 二、实验条件 下载并安装Jmeter软件。 Jmeter主要测试组件说明: 1.测试计划是使用JMeter进行测试的起点,它是其它JMeter测试元件的容器。 2.线程组:代表一定数量的并发用户,可以用来模拟并发用户的发送请求。实际的请求内容再sampler中定义,它被线程组包含,可以在测试计划--添加--线程组来建立,在线程组面板里有几个输入栏:线程数、Ramp-UpPeriod(inseconds)、循环次数,其中Ramp-UpPeriod(inseconds)表示在这时间内创建完所有的线程。如有8个线程,Ramp-Up=200秒,那么线程的启动时间间隔为200/8=25秒,这样的好处是:一开始不会对服务器有太大的负载。线程组是为模拟并发负载而设计。 3.取样器:模拟各种请求。所有实际的测试任务都由取样器承担,存在很多种请求。如:HTTP请求 4.监听器:负责收集测试结果,同时也被告知了结果显示的方式。功能是对取样器的请求结果显示、统计一些数据等。如:用表格察看结果,图形结果 5.断言:用于来判断请求响应的结果是否如用户所期望,是否正确。它可以用来隔离问题域,即在确保功能正确的前提下执行压力测试。 6.定时器:负责定义请求之间的延迟间隔,模拟对服务器的连续请求。 7.逻辑控制器:允许自定义JMeter发送请求的行为逻辑,它与Sampler结合使用可以模拟复杂的请求序列。 8.配置元件维护Sampler需要的配置信息,并根据实际的需要会修改请求的内容。 9.前置处理器和后置处理器负责在生成请求之前和之后完成工作。前置处理器常常用来修改请求的设置,后置处理器则常常用来处理响应的数据。 本次实验以某教育网站新闻页面为测试用例:(/retype/zoom/1ae1eea32f60ddccdb38a034?pn=3x=0y=0raww=893rawh=395o=png_6_0_0_0_0_0_0__type=picaimh=md5sum=94c64220f484cc066c41ab7f6a2b2a9asign=0a9015f1a9zoom=png=144-43679jpg=0-0target=_blank点此查看 HTTP请求图形结果 用表格察看结果: 图形结果: 以上是一个简单web压力测试步骤。 四、实验总结 在本次的简单实验中,我们初步地掌握了Jmeter的简单web测试应用,让我们对压力测试有一个初步的了解,能让我们在今后的学习(来自:写论文网:jmeter,生成测试报告)中具有一定的基础,能更好地进行进一步得学习;关于Jmeter测试的其他应用,我们以后要慢慢了解、学习,如果有机会希望可以为Jmeter测试软件贡献自己的力量。 1. 2. 3. 4.下载jmeter下载ant配置好jmeter和ant的bin目录到环境变量中将jmeter的extras目录中包拷贝至ant安装目录下的lib目录中,这 样Ant运行时才能找到这个类,从而成功触发JMeter脚本 5.把脚本写好之后,放到extras目录下 6.拷贝到ant的lib目录 7.jmeter默认保存的是.csv格式的文件,所以我们先要设置一下bin/文件内容,保存 _format=xml 8.编写下面的文件 参考:http:///hellotest/blog/ 或者http:///blog/
文档评论(0)